Rainy day at Kylemore Abbey, Connemara, Ireland
Sitting on the edge of a lake, surrounded by mountains and forests, Kylemore Abbey is one of the most visited tourist attractions in the west of Ireland. Now a Benedictine monastery, the 70 room 40,000 square feet castle was built in the 1860s by a wealthy businessman as a present for his wife.
